Editorial Reviews

Review

"A major contribution to the history of the international peace movement.... No single review can do it justice." -- The Nonviolent Activist, Spring 2004

"Astonishing in scope and compelling in argument.... It lays a path for historians around the world." -- New Zealand Journal of History, April 2004

"For clues about how to save the planet from nuclear extinction, there is no better place to turn." -- The Progressive, March 2004

"The saga of the world ... movement, whose complex strands Lawrence Wittner has brilliantly woven together ... deserves the widest possible readership." -- Bulletin of the Atomic Scientists, January-February 2004

"[This] outstanding book employs massive research ... to show how concerned and determined citizens ... have altered the course of history.... Monumental." -- The Journal of American History, September 2004
